Being given a 5-star rating excludes a couple of needed components. Attitude and Maximizing one's talent.

There are kids that "peak" in High School. They're all downhill after that. Attitude is huge.
Football is a journey, not a destination. If you enter college believing you don't have to improve,
you're in deep trouble.

I can think of Xavier Lee at FSU. Now he was a 5-star all-thru HS but I believe he was a 4 when
he signed his LOI. He was a man-child at Seabreeze. Totally dominant, but playing in a mid-range
classification. He thrived on the broken play. He was 6-4 240 with ample speed. He just dropped
back and then took off. He didn't care what the play was. BUT, he had talent and he had
promise. If he would have had some common sense he probably would have been good.
He just couldn't discipline himself to do the needed work, like learning the playbook to ever
be successful. In HS he faced a lot of players that didn't belong on the same field as him. In
college everybody belonged on that field and it wasn't easy for him anymore and he couldn't
work hard enough to regain his edge.
